The Cellular Reset: Senolytics and Autophagy Activators

One of the most profound discoveries in longevity science is the role of "senescent cells" – often called "zombie cells." These are old, damaged cells that refuse to die, instead lingering in our tissues, spewing inflammatory compounds that accelerate aging and disease. In 2026, the strategic removal of these cellular saboteurs is becoming a cornerstone of anti-aging protocols.

Senolytics, compounds that selectively destroy senescent cells, are gaining significant traction. We're seeing wider availability and deeper understanding of combinations like Dasatinib and Quercetin (D+Q), which are showing promising results in clinical trials for conditions ranging from idiopathic pulmonary fibrosis to Alzheimer's. Beyond prescription, natural senolytics like Fisetin (found in strawberries) and higher doses of Quercetin (in apples, onions) are being incorporated into targeted supplement regimens, often in pulsed doses to maximize efficacy and minimize side effects.

Equally critical is the activation of autophagy, the body's natural cellular clean-up process. Think of it as your cells recycling their old, damaged components to build new, healthier ones. While intermittent fasting and extended fasting remain powerful autophagy activators, compounds like Spermidine (found in wheat germ, aged cheese, mushrooms) and Urolithin A (derived from pomegranates by gut bacteria) are emerging as potent pharmacological inducers. These aren't just trendy supplements; they're backed by robust science demonstrating their ability to enhance mitochondrial function and extend lifespan in various organisms.

Metabolic Mastery: Continuous Glucose Monitoring (CGM) and Ketone Tracking Redefined

Your metabolism is the engine of your longevity, and in 2026, we have unprecedented visibility into its performance. Continuous Glucose Monitors (CGMs), once exclusive to diabetics, are now mainstream tools for metabolic optimization. These discreet sensors, often worn on the arm, provide real-time data on how different foods, exercises, and even stress impact your blood sugar levels. But the 2026 iteration is smarter: AI integration now offers predictive insights, warning you of potential glucose spikes before they happen and suggesting immediate interventions.

Beyond glucose, ketone tracking is evolving from a niche for ketogenic dieters to a powerful indicator of metabolic flexibility. Advanced breath and blood ketone meters, often integrated with CGM apps, help you understand when your body is efficiently burning fat for fuel. This metabolic flexibility – the ability to seamlessly switch between glucose and fat utilization – is a hallmark of youthful metabolism and a key predictor of healthspan. The Gut-Brain Axis: Microbiome Engineering for Longevity

Your gut is often called your "second brain," and in 2026, it's increasingly recognized as a central command center for longevity. The trillions of microorganisms residing in your digestive tract, collectively known as the microbiome, influence everything from nutrient absorption and immune function to mood, cognition, and even the rate at which you age. Dysbiosis – an imbalance in your gut flora – is linked to chronic inflammation, metabolic disorders, and neurodegenerative diseases.

The exciting news is that microbiome engineering is becoming incredibly sophisticated. Beyond generic probiotics, 2026 offers precision prebiotics and probiotics, often recommended based on advanced stool analysis that maps your unique microbial landscape. AI algorithms now analyze your microbiome profile and suggest specific strains of bacteria or types of fiber to cultivate a diverse, resilient gut ecosystem. We're also seeing advancements in targeted phage therapy (using viruses to kill specific unwanted bacteria) and, for more severe cases, refined approaches to Fecal Microbiota Transplantation (FMT), moving towards "designer" microbial cocktails rather than broad spectrum transplants.
